[Pkg-octave-devel] Bug#740984: octave-vrml: unversioned Depends entries break Octave 3.8.0

Aaron M. Ucko ucko at debian.org
Fri Mar 7 00:29:10 UTC 2014


Package: octave-vrml
Version: 1.0.13-1
Severity: grave
Justification: renders package unusable (uninstallable)

It's impossible to configure octave 3.8.0 with octave-vrml installed:

Processing triggers for octave (3.8.0-5) ...
error: strcmp: nonconformant cell arrays
error: evaluating argument list element number 1
error: called from:
error:   /usr/share/octave/3.8.0/m/pkg/private/fix_depends.m at line 46, column 9
error:   /usr/share/octave/3.8.0/m/pkg/private/get_description.m at line 74, column 18
error:   /usr/share/octave/3.8.0/m/pkg/private/rebuild.m at line 50, column 12
error:   /usr/share/octave/3.8.0/m/pkg/pkg.m at line 495, column 25
dpkg: error processing package octave (--unpack):
 subprocess installed post-installation script returned error exit status 1
Errors were encountered while processing:
 octave

The problem appears to be that most of the Depends entries in
octave-vrml's DESCRIPTION file lack version requirements; could you
please take a look, and either fix octave to permit such entries or
octave-vrml not to supply them?

Thanks!

-- System Information:
Debian Release: jessie/sid
  APT prefers testing
  APT policy: (500, 'testing'), (500, 'stable'), (300, 'unstable')
Architecture: amd64 (x86_64)
Foreign Architectures: i386

Kernel: Linux 3.13-1-amd64 (SMP w/4 CPU cores)
Locale: LANG=en_US.UTF-8, LC_CTYPE=en_US.UTF-8 (charmap=UTF-8)
Shell: /bin/sh linked to /bin/dash

Versions of packages octave-vrml depends on:
ih  octave                 3.8.0-5
ii  octave-linear-algebra  2.2.0-1+b1
ii  octave-miscellaneous   1.2.0-2+b1
ii  octave-statistics      1.2.3-1
ii  octave-struct          1.0.10-1+b1
ii  whitedune              0.30.10-1.2

octave-vrml recommends no packages.

octave-vrml suggests no packages.

-- no debconf information



More information about the Pkg-octave-devel mailing list